Before Creating a Channel

1. Deciding a Niche

YouTube algorithm loves it when your channel is focused on the field of content. Your niche allows it to choose the audience to recommend your videos well. This eventually gets you more impressions as well as a new unique audience.

Even before starting a YouTube channel, Decide your niche for example you will be creating videos on Unboxing Gadgets. So your top-level field will be technology and your direct niche would be unboxing gadgets

Stick to your niche and create content focused solely on that one domain. You can try to do multiple things while staying connected with your domain. Like you can provide Technology tips, tricks, and solve technology-related problems.

But you should never be mixing your content which hurts your channel growth. Suppose if you are starting a Maths YouTube Channel then don’t try to add music videos or any other kind of video content.

3. Get Your Channel a Name

Name is one of the most important factors while creating a new YouTube Channel. Choose something unique which could be easily distinguished from other channels.

Never try to choose generic terms as your channel name for example “Tech News“, “Comedy Videos“. Because for these keywords there are many channels and videos ranking which would make it difficult to come in search results.

4. Be Prepared in Advance

Don’t just create a video and start uploading it randomly. Create at least 5-10 videos with all your channel branding like Logo, YouTube thumbnail design, Channel Banner, etc.

Most of the people just leave their channel after 1 or 2 videos. Either they are not interested in it anymore or they are not able to create content further due to lack of ideas.

So be prepared with at least 5 to 10 videos in advance which also strengthens up your confidence.

6. Updating the Channel Description

Channel Description is the ultimate place to reach out to the audience. Most of the people ignore this place and write just a one or two liner description.

But here is a catch, You can use your keywords in this area which will let your channel rank better in YouTube searches. Every time when someone writes in a query the algorithm finds the most relevant videos and channels to show.

If you will use the keywords effectively then there are chances that you might rank for them. You should be choosing low competitive keywords, Keyword tools could be used to find that.

Not only keywords but it is the perfect place to introduce yourself to the end audience. Once the users are satisfied with your description they might add themselves to your Subscribers list. So it will surely help you to get Free Youtube Subscribers and Views.

8.  Optimizing Your Video Description

YouTube allows us to have a description of 5000 words for each video. You should describe the video content in brief and also link all your playlists, Social media profiles in the video description.

If you have used any copyrighted content then you can link back to the original resource as well. Moreover, this is the place to embed more of your video related keywords. But it should not look like a mess and the keyword density should be kept in mind.

SEO plays a great role in ranking your videos and Video description helps in optimizing the same.

11. Use of End Screens

Most of the new YouTubers ignore using this amazing feature known as End Screen. It allows the content creators to embed multiple things at the end of any uploaded video.

This way you can embed your playlists, recent videos, subscribe button at the end of any video. People usually go away from the channel after watching a video but it will allow you to create a user flow.

They will move from one video to another which also increases user engagement. As user engagement is one of the most important factors for deciding channel ranking in searches. Thus always create an end screen having related videos, playlists, outbound links, or a Subscribe button.

12. Using YouTube Cards

Cards are small notifications that appear while watching any videos. They can be used to notify viewers of something related to the video. Suppose you have explained a topic in your previous video and you want to give a reference to that point.

In this situation, Cards could be used to create a simple notification without any actual disturbance. This might help you in multiple situations and you can find out more details here YouTube Cards

14. Creating Playlists

A playlist is a group of related videos mostly arranged in a sequence. All the top YouTube Channels usually upload tutorials in a sequence which they group in a playlist.

Playlists have many benefits and some of them are mentioned below:

  • Every playlist has its own description where you can use your keywords. Explain the playlist well and embed related low competitive keywords.
  • Playlists also rank in YouTube searches which allows you to have an extra benefit.
  • Each playlist has its own name which provides you a way to embed keywords.
  • They help you in getting user engagement as they play in a sequence of your videos.

Having so many benefits makes them an obvious choice for most of the content creators. It is very easy to create Playlists and you can Google it down for a tutorial.

15. Analyzing the Results

For getting ahead from your competitors you always need to keep yourself updated. YouTube provides analytics to show you the reports for your channel.

Here you can check the following things:

  • Your current Subscribers and Views
  • Sources of Traffic
  • Search Terms for which Your Channel got impressions
  • Views for each individual videos
  • Most Popular content from your YouTube channel

Analytic reports will help you to work on things that need your attention. You will also be working more on things that are bringing you much traffic to your Channel.
